Currently, South Korea’s industrial landscape is characterized by a high concentration of energy-intensive sectors such as petrochemicals, steel manufacturing, and electronics. These industries are actively adopting co-generation systems to optimize energy consumption and reduce operational costs. The government’s supportive policies, coupled with technological advancements in gas turbine efficiency, are further accelerating market expansion. As a result, the South Korea Gas Turbine Co-generation System Market is positioned as a vital component of the country’s broader energy infrastructure, with significant implications for future industrial growth and energy resilience.

Enterprise Adoption Trends in South Korea

Large enterprises in South Korea are leading the adoption of gas turbine co-generation systems, leveraging these solutions to achieve operational efficiencies and meet sustainability targets. Many industrial giants in sectors such as chemicals, steel, and electronics have integrated co-generation into their energy management strategies, often combining these systems with digital platforms for real-time monitoring and optimization.

Small and medium-sized enterprises (SMEs) are gradually adopting co-generation solutions as costs decrease and technological maturity improves. Industry vertical demand remains strong, with energy-intensive sectors prioritizing co-generation to reduce reliance on grid power and fossil fuels. Moreover, the integration of AI, automation, and cloud-based data platforms is enabling enterprises to enhance system reliability, predict maintenance needs, and optimize energy consumption, thus supporting broader digital transformation initiatives.

Market Challenges and Restraints

Despite the promising outlook, several challenges constrain the growth of the South Korea Gas Turbine Co-generation System Market. High initial capital expenditure remains a significant barrier for many organizations, particularly SMEs. Regulatory complexities and evolving compliance standards can also delay project deployment and increase costs.

  • Cost barriers: The capital-intensive nature of co-generation systems limits widespread adoption, especially among smaller firms.
  • Regulatory complexities: Navigating South Korea’s evolving energy policies and environmental regulations can pose operational hurdles.
  • Infrastructure limitations: Existing energy infrastructure may require upgrades to support large-scale co-generation deployment, adding to project costs.
  • Market competition: The presence of alternative energy solutions, such as renewable power and battery storage, introduces competitive pressures.
  • Supply chain constraints: Disruptions in component supply or technological components can impact project timelines and costs.
